To retrieve the radio code for your 2018 Fiat 500, start by checking the owner's manual or any documentation that came with your vehicle, as the code is often noted there. If you can't find it in the manual, inspect your glove compartment or trunk for a sticker that may contain the radio code. Sometimes, the code is also located on the sides of the radio itself, so a quick visual check can be beneficial. If these methods do not yield results, your next step should be to contact a Fiat dealership. Be prepared to provide your vehicle identification number (VIN) and the serial number of your radio, as this information will help them retrieve the code for you. When a 2018 Fiat 500 requires a radio code, it often stems from a few common issues that can disrupt the radio's functionality. One prevalent reason is a dead or disconnected battery, which can occur after leaving lights on or during extreme weather conditions. Additionally, if the battery has been replaced or disconnected for maintenance, the radio may prompt for a code as a security measure. Software updates can also trigger this requirement, as they may reset the radio system. To resolve these issues, first, locate the radio code, which is typically found in the owner's manual or on a card provided by the manufacturer. If you cannot find it, contacting a Fiat dealership is a reliable option. Once you have the code, enter it using the radio preset buttons, following the specific instructions in your manual. After successfully entering the code, the radio should reset and function normally. It’s advisable to keep the radio code in a secure location for future reference, ensuring you can quickly address any similar issues that may arise.
